Ok, to answer your question (unlike 7 out of 8 replies) here we go....I ran mine to the parking lights. Just take out the parking light (twist it) then disconnect the harness from the bulb. You have three wires running to the harness, RED, BLACK, and GREEN. RED is to make the parking lights go on, BLACK is ground and GREEN is to make them blink (but they don't stay on with the parking lights). Just take the wire and slide it into either the RED or the GREEN coresponding slot. I hooked mine up to the blinkers (GREEN). Then just put the harness back together, then just connect the BLACK wire (ground) to any metal bolt. check to make sure it works, then put back the bulb. Repeat for other side. It was pretty easy, easier than installing the suckers.

Well if you want them to come on with your headlights, the use the RED wire slot. Since the parking lights come on with the headlights, the LEDs will light up when the headlights are on. I haven't tried hooking them up directly to the headlights (at least not on my car). You can do it by taking out the bulb and stuff, but it is too complicated and hooking them up to the parking lights is easier and you get the same results.
